Understanding Electrostatic Precipitators

An electrostatic precipitator, often often called an ESP, is really an air filtration gadget that removes high-quality particles, like dust and smoke, from the flowing gasoline utilizing the pressure of an induced electrostatic demand. This technology can be a staple in industrial air pollution answers and is particularly helpful in capturing airborne particles from textile generation processes. the look and performance of the ESP make it an excellent choice for cutting down emissions in industries where by air high quality is a concern, such as textile production. In textile manufacturing, ESPs serve as an important part in controlling emissions. Amongst the myriad pollutants released in the course of textile manufacturing, Kleanland's ESP competently capture natural oils, dyes, Industrial Exhaust Control and fiber particles, which happen to be widespread by-products and solutions of the procedure. By purifying the air, ESPs lead to your cleaner production environment and support textile makers adhere to stringent environmental polices. These programs are not just successful but additionally adaptable, capable of being customized to meet unique wants of different textile processing units.
